**Mgmt Meeting Minutes — Retiring the Brightline Range**

Quick recap for sales leads at Fenholt Supplies: we agreed to retire the Brightline fixture range by year-end. Remaining stock moves to clearance pricing next month, and accounts on standing orders get migrated to the Lumetta range. Trade-in incentives were approved in principle. The confidential note on next steps sits just below.

board note of bajof-bajeg: The pricing group signed off on a budget of $13.4 million for Project Sildor. The renewal with Lamixek Holdings closes at $48.9 million a year, 49 percent above the last contract.

Subject: DR drill — Thumbforge queue, results

Drill complete. We failed over the Thumbforge thumbnail queue to the Eastvale standby cluster, replayed 40k pending jobs, zero loss. One finding for your review: the queue's encrypted checkpoint store would not auto-unseal on standby; operators had to unseal manually. That step is now documented in the DR runbook. For your verification of the manual path, the unseal requires the recovery passphrase, which I am including directly below this message.

unlock words, yawig-kagef: gordor-holvan-ulaael-pramir-ulaiel-tamdor

Subject: RBAC ownership change — Fernwiki

Team,

Effective Monday, role-based access control in Fernwiki moves from the Platform pod to the Identity pod. This covers role definitions, permission inheritance, space-level overrides, and the quarterly access review. Open tickets in the RBAC backlog transfer automatically; in-flight migrations finish under the old pod by Friday. Raise escalations in the eng sync rather than side channels until the handover settles. The new accountable owner is listed below.

account owner for bawip-tahag: Raleth Quenok

### Checklist: Leaked File Descriptor Hunt — Marrowline Gateway

Before signing off this release, run the descriptor audit on a staging node that has soaked for at least six hours. Compare open-handle counts between idle and peak load; anything growing monotonically is a leak candidate. Pay special attention to the retry path in the Ketterman upload module, which historically forgot to close temp files on timeout. Record your findings in the release log, and attach the build token shown beneath this item.

trace token, tawep-fahif: htk3_b58